预计到2034年,数位化供应链市场规模将从2024年的214亿美元成长至461亿美元,年复合成长率约为8%。数位化供应链市场涵盖了物联网、人工智慧、区块链和云端运算等数位化和优化供应链流程的技术和解决方案。这些创新技术提高了整个供应链的透明度、效率和协作性,从而实现即时数据分析和决策。随着企业寻求增强韧性和敏捷性,在对透明度、成本降低和提升客户体验的需求驱动下,该市场蓄势待发,即将迎来成长。

受对提升营运效率和即时数据视觉性日益增长的需求驱动,数位化供应链市场正经历强劲成长。软体在这一市场中尤为突出,供应链规划和执行解决方案对于优化物流和库存管理至关重要。供应链分析和人工智慧工具也发展迅猛,提供预测性洞察和决策支援。虽然硬体并非主要因素,但物联网设备和感测器的普及(对货物的即时追踪和监控至关重要)值得关注。云端平台凭藉其扩充性、柔软性和跨全球网路的无缝整合能力,正逐渐占据主导地位。然而,对于那些优先考虑资料安全和控制的企业而言,本地部署解决方案仍然十分重要。混合模式能够为供应链管理提供平衡的解决方案,并且日益受到青睐。旨在提升透明度和可追溯性的区块链技术投资也推动了市场动态,预示着未来创新和效率提升的方向。

主要趋势和驱动因素:

数位化供应链市场正经历变革性成长,这主要得益于人工智慧和机器学习等先进技术的快速普及。这些技术能够实现预测分析和即时决策,进而提升供应链的效率和韧性。关键趋势包括物联网设备的整合(可提供供应链营运的详细视觉性)以及区块链技术的应用(可确保整个供应链网路的透明度和可追溯性)。另一个关键驱动因素是市场全球化和对更快交付速度的需求,这推动了对供应链敏捷性和应对力的需求。企业正在投资数位化解决方案,以提高营运效率并缩短前置作业时间,从而获得竞争优势。电子商务的兴起和全通路零售的转型进一步加速了数位化供应链的创新,因为企业都在努力满足不断变化的消费者期望。永续性也是一个关键趋势,各组织都在优先考虑环保实践并减少碳足迹。这推动了能够优化资源利用和最大限度减少废弃物的数位化工具的应用。基于云端的平台和协作生态系统的开发存在着许多机会,这些平台和生态系统能够实现无缝的资讯交流并加强供应链协作。随着数位转型不断改变各行各业,数位供应链市场预计将经历强劲成长,为具有前瞻性思维的公司提供盈利前景。

限制与挑战:

目前,数位化供应链市场面临诸多限制和挑战。其中一个关键挑战是将旧有系统与新兴数位技术融合,而这往往是一项成本高且复杂的工程。许多企业难以更新过时的基础设施,导致效率低下和资料孤岛。此外,随着数位化供应链互联互通程度的加深,网路安全威胁也日益加剧。确保稳健的安全措施需要大量的投资和专业知识,而并非所有企业都具备这些条件。此外,缺乏具备数位化供应链管理专业知识的熟练人才也阻碍了先进解决方案的有效实施。科技的快速变革意味着企业必须不断调整自身以保持竞争力,而这需要耗费大量资源。最后,区域资源彙整合规性也增加了复杂性,因为企业必须遵守不同的标准和要求,这进一步加剧了全球供应链营运的难度。所有这些挑战迭加在一起,阻碍了供应链向完全数位化生态系统的无缝转型。

Digital Supply Chain Market is anticipated to expand from $21.4 billion in 2024 to $46.1 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of approximately 8%. The Digital Supply Chain Market encompasses technologies and solutions that digitize and optimize supply chain processes, including IoT, AI, blockchain, and cloud computing. These innovations enhance visibility, efficiency, and collaboration across the supply chain, enabling real-time data analytics and decision-making. As businesses seek resilience and agility, the market is poised for growth, driven by the need for transparency, cost reduction, and improved customer experience.

The Digital Supply Chain Market is experiencing robust growth, propelled by the increasing need for enhanced operational efficiency and real-time data visibility. Within this market, the software segment stands out, particularly in supply chain planning and execution solutions, which are critical for optimizing logistics and inventory management. Supply chain analytics and artificial intelligence tools are also gaining momentum, offering predictive insights and decision-making capabilities. The hardware segment, while secondary, is marked by the proliferation of IoT devices and sensors, crucial for real-time tracking and monitoring of goods. Cloud-based platforms are emerging as a dominant force due to their scalability and flexibility, enabling seamless integration across global networks. On-premise solutions, however, continue to hold significance for organizations prioritizing data security and control. Hybrid models are increasingly favored, providing a balanced approach to supply chain management. Investment in blockchain technology for enhanced transparency and traceability is also contributing to market dynamism, indicating a future trajectory of innovation and efficiency.

Geographical Overview:

The digital supply chain market is witnessing substantial growth across various regions, with each presenting unique opportunities. North America remains at the forefront due to technological advancements and strong digital infrastructure. Companies are increasingly investing in supply chain digitization to enhance efficiency and competitiveness. The region's mature market is supported by a robust technological ecosystem and a focus on innovation. Europe is experiencing significant growth, driven by stringent regulatory frameworks and a focus on sustainable practices. The region's emphasis on reducing carbon footprints and enhancing supply chain transparency is propelling market expansion. In Asia Pacific, rapid industrialization and urbanization are key drivers. Countries like China and India are emerging as lucrative growth pockets, fueled by investments in digital technologies and smart logistics solutions.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a are also showing promising potential. In Latin America, digital transformation initiatives in supply chains are gaining momentum. The Middle East & Africa are recognizing the strategic importance of digital supply chains in fostering economic diversification and resilience.

Key Trends and Drivers:

The digital supply chain market is experiencing transformative growth, driven by the rapid adoption of adv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ence and machine learning. These technologies enable predictive analytics and real-time decision-making, enhancing supply chain efficiency and resilience. Key trends include the integration of Internet of Things (IoT) devices, which provide granular visibility into supply chain operations, and blockchain technology, ensuring transparency and traceability across the supply network. Another significant driver is the increasing demand for supply chain agility and responsiveness, prompted by the globalization of markets and the need for faster delivery times. Companies are investing in digital solutions to streamline operations and reduce lead times, thereby gaining a competitive edge. The rise of e-commerce and the shift towards omnichannel retailing are further propelling digital supply chain innovations, as businesses seek to meet evolving consumer expectations. Sustainability is also a pivotal trend, with organizations prioritizing eco-friendly practices and carbon footprint reduction. This is fostering the adoption of digital tools that optimize resource utilization and minimize waste. Opportunities abound in the development of cloud-based platforms and collaborative ecosystems that facilitate seamless information exchange and enhance supply chain collaboration. As digital transformation continues to reshape the industry, the digital supply chain market is poised for robust expansion, offering lucrative prospects for forward-thinking enterprises.

Restraints and Challenges:

The digital supply chain market is currently navigating a landscape fraught with notable restraints and challenges. A significant challenge is the integration of legacy systems with new digital technologies, which can be costly and complex. Many organizations struggle to update outdated infrastructure, leading to inefficiencies and data silos. Additionally, cybersecurity threats pose a growing risk, as digital supply chains become more interconnected and vulnerable to attacks. Ensuring robust security measures requires substantial investment and expertise, which not all companies possess. Furthermore, the lack of skilled personnel with expertise in digital supply chain management hinders the effective implementation of advanced solutions. The rapid pace of technological change also means that companies must continuously adapt to stay competitive, which can be resource-intensive. Lastly, regulatory compliance in different regions creates complexities, as companies must navigate varying standards and requirements, complicating global supply chain operations. These challenges collectively impede the seamless transformation of supply chains into fully digital ecosystems.
